LASIK Improvement
If your vision is not perfectly clear after LASIK, you might be qualified for a LASIK enhancement. LASIK enhancement is a fast and also painless follow-up procedure that boosts aesthetic results after the initial laser eye surgical procedure.
LASIK improvement is similar to the very first LASIK surgery, except it does not need a brand-new corneal flap to be reduced. Rather, your specialist merely raises the existing flap and re-uses the excimer laser to improve the cornea.
The best prospects for LASIK enhancement are those that have healthy and balanced eyes and also can undertake the therapy rapidly and quickly. LASIK Hyperopia
Laser eye surgery is most frequently utilized to treat nearsightedness (myopia), but can additionally work for farsightedness, or hyperopia. With laser refractive surgical procedure, a specialized laser ablates the cornea as well as reshapes it so light appropriately concentrates on the retina.
The laser transforms the shape of the cornea to make sure that it is steeper as well as much longer, lengthening the emphasis of beams. This enables them to focus straight on the retina, giving clients clear vision.
